Radar data from Mars Advanced Radar for Subsurface and Ionospheric Sounding (MARSIS) reveals a significant water reservoir under the surface of Mars , in the Medusae Fossae region.

Scientists suggest that its volume is comparable to the Red Sea .

Discovery of ice deposits in the equatorial region suggests that Mars might have once had a much wetter environment.
